Job description

We are looking for a skilled Assembler to join our team and play a key role in assembling our level and flow control products. In this position, you will follow job specifications, identify nonconforming conditions, and collaborate with the Team Lead and/or Supervisor to address any issues. You will also contribute to identifying and reducing waste in the workflow to improve overall efficiency.

 

The Assembler I will:

  • Execute standard work with support from others on complex tasks.
  • Operate and inspect Value Stream workstation output.
  • Operate and inspect all tools and equipment necessary to execute standard work.
  • Test and calibrate simple assemblies according to specifications.
  • Execute standard work with an acceptable degree of quality and limited quality discrepancies, showing a trend of improvement.
  • Execute standard work efficiently on simple tasks with support from others on complex tasks.
  • Identify problems in execution of standard work and request help from others on resolution.
  • Other duties as assigned.

 

Assembler I Position Requirements:

  •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, color vision and depth perception.
  • Ability to lift or carry up to 50lbs.
  • Some duties require walking, standing, bending, or climbing for extended periods.
  • 0-3 years assembly experience.
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Ability to read and write English.
  • Basic computer literacy using Microsoft Windows.
  • Basic math skills and ability to use basic measurement equipment (ruler, scale, calipers, tape measure).
